F1 signs major partnership with Aramco

This is undoubtedly a new key step on the road which should lead to the holding of a first Saudi Arabian Grand Prix in the near future. 

La Formula 1 has just announced the signing of a major sponsorship agreement with the Saudi oil company Saudi Aramco. 

The press release sent by Liberty Media states that Aramco and F1 will work together to “ identify ways to develop and promote biofuels, improve engine efficiency and encourage the emergence of new mobility technologies ».

The agreement between the two parties also provides for Aramco to be the title sponsor of the 2020 Spanish, Hungarian and United States Grands Prix and to have strong advertising visibility around most of the circuits on the calendar. . 

« We are very pleased to partner with Formula 1, which offers a global showcase thanks to its millions of fans across the planet, commented Amin H. Nasser, CEO of Saudi Aramco. As a world leader in energy supply and innovation, we aim to find sustainable and new solutions to bring to life even more efficient and environmentally friendly engines. ». 

At the end of 2019, F1 revealed its ambition to present a neutral carbon footprint by 2030, while Saudi Arabia has been working for several months to soon host a Formula 1 Grand Prix in Qiddiya, in the heart of a huge complex dedicated to entertainment and located about forty from the capital Riyadh.
